Understanding the Importance of Audio Drivers

Audio drivers serve as the communication bridge between your computer’s operating system and the audio hardware, in this case, the audio chipset integrated into the ASRock 890GX Extreme4 motherboard. Without the correct drivers, your system may not be able to recognize the audio hardware, resulting in a lack of sound output or malfunctioning audio devices like microphones. Outdated or corrupted drivers can also lead to various audio-related problems, including:

  • No sound output: The most common symptom of a driver issue.
  • Distorted or crackling audio: Interference or incompatibility issues can cause audio to sound unnatural.
  • Microphone malfunction: Issues with input devices preventing proper communication or recording.
  • Inability to use specific audio features: Advanced audio settings or enhancements may not function correctly.
  • System instability: In rare cases, faulty drivers can lead to system crashes or freezes.

Alternative Installation Method: Device Manager

If the setup file method doesn’t work, or if you prefer a manual installation, you can use the Device Manager:

  1. Open Device Manager: Press the Windows key + R, type "devmgmt.msc," and press Enter.
  2. Locate the Audio Device: In Device Manager, expand "Sound, video and game controllers." Look for your audio device (it might be listed as "Unknown device" or with a generic name).
  3. Update Driver: Right-click on the audio device and select "Update driver."
  4. Browse My Computer: Choose "Browse my computer for drivers."
  5. Specify Driver Location: Browse to the folder where you extracted the driver files and select the folder containing the driver information file (.inf file).
  6. Follow the On-Screen Instructions: Windows will install the driver.
  7. Restart Your Computer: Restart your computer after the installation is complete.

Troubleshooting Common Audio Issues

If you encounter problems after installing the ASRock 890GX Extreme4 Audio Driver R2.51, try the following troubleshooting steps:

  • Check Volume Levels: Ensure that the volume is not muted and that the volume levels are set appropriately in both Windows and the audio application you are using.
  • Check Audio Device Selection: Make sure the correct audio device is selected as the default playback device in Windows sound settings. Right-click the volume icon in the system tray, select "Open Sound settings," and choose the correct output device.
  • Roll Back the Driver: If the new driver is causing problems, you can roll back to the previous driver version. In Device Manager, right-click on the audio device, select "Properties," go to the "Driver" tab, and click "Roll Back Driver."
  • Uninstall and Reinstall the Driver: If rolling back doesn’t work, try uninstalling the driver completely and then reinstalling it.
  • Check for Hardware Conflicts: In Device Manager, look for any yellow exclamation marks next to any devices. This indicates a potential hardware conflict.
  • Run the Windows Audio Troubleshooter: Windows has a built-in audio troubleshooter that can automatically detect and fix common audio problems.
  • Update BIOS: In rare cases, an outdated BIOS can cause compatibility issues. Check the ASRock website for BIOS updates for your motherboard. Warning: Updating the BIOS can be risky, so proceed with caution and follow the manufacturer’s instructions carefully.
  • Check Speakers and Cables: Ensure that your speakers are properly connected and that the cables are not damaged.
